ICD-10-CMThis code signifies a sprain of the temporomandibular joint (TMJ) on the right side, representing a late effect or complication of an initial injury. It indicates that the patient is experiencing residual symptoms or conditions directly resulting from a previous right jaw sprain.
Apply this code when documentation clearly states a patient is presenting with chronic pain, limited range of motion, or other persistent issues on the right side of the jaw that are directly attributed to a past sprain. This code is appropriate when the acute phase of the injury has passed, and the current encounter addresses the long-term consequences.
